The area studies major at Coe is not ranked on College Factual’s Best Colleges and Universities for Area Studies. This could be for a number of reasons, such as not having enough data on the major or school to make an accurate assessment of its quality.

During the 2020-2021 academic year, Coe College handed out 5 bachelor's degrees in area studies. This is a decrease of 44% over the previous year when 9 degrees were handed out.

Coe Area Studies Bachelor’s Program

The area studies program at Coe awarded 5 bachelor's degrees in 2020-2021. About 40% of these degrees went to men with the other 60% going to women.

undefined

The majority of the students with this major are white. About 100% of 2021 graduates were in this category.
